This song was in the top 40 back in the day, ans relatively popular for several months. Unfortunately for Ms. Bass, it was her only hit. She was what you could call a "one hit wonder". There were many one hit wonders such as Billy Paul (Me and Mrs Jones), Doris Troy – "Just One Look" (1963), Deon Jackson – "Love Makes the World Go Round" (1966), Looking Glass – "Brandy (You're a Fine Girl)" (1972), Alicia Bridges – "I Love the Nightlife" (1978), etc.

Bronx23- - - -A friend turned me on to Eva Cassidy's work several years ago and I also am a huge fan!
I have 12 Eva CD's, they are: Nightbird 2015
The Other Side w/Chuck Brown 1992
Songbird 1992
Eva By Heart 1997
Live At Blues Alley 1996
Somewhere 2008
Simply Eva 2011
Time After Time 2000
No Boundaries 2000
Method Actor 2002
Imagine 2002
American Tune 2003
After her passing in 1996 her parents & friends set up a website evacassidy.org and are trying to keep her legacy alive with additional CD's from studio sessions that never got put out in public! Also go to google search or yahoo search for Eva Cassidy on ABC NIGHTLINE which has a story on her life, which is excellent!
There was also a book of her story put out by Gotham Books written by Rob Burley, Jonathan Maitland, & Elana Rhodes Byrd which is also excellent!
